Transaction 105ef98934080136020b7d23d522f90eeca83258bc0c239f5f02c6024239d97f
1 Input
1 Output
-
105ef98934080136020b7d23d522f90eeca83258bc0c239f5f02c6024239d97f:0
- value
- 11824752
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fca90e5ea918d4be7fe8a730ebdd2e0b946f80f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KwhYF2jBuundsLzJsMNizvcKvm9gvzsEF